Add 25/72 and 4/9
25/72 + 4/9 is 19/24.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 72 and 9 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 72 × 1 = 72,
25/72 = 25 × 1/72 × 1 = 25/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 8 = 72,
4/9 = 4 × 8/9 × 8 = 32/72 - Add the two like fractions:
25/72 + 32/72 = 25 + 32/72 = 57/72 - 57/72 simplified gives 19/24
- So, 25/72 + 4/9 = 19/24
